Cooperative communications has recently been introduced into multiple-access networks to combat the signal attenuation caused by fading and therefore improve the network performance. This study proposes the outage probability and error analysis of cooperative interleave-division multiple-access (IDMA) networks with regenerative relays over Weibull fading channels. The main contribution of this study relies on deriving a moment-generating function (MGF) of the total signal-to-noise ratio with the help of Pade approximation for IDMA with regenerative relaying. The derived MGF expression is employed to evaluate the outage probability of the considered system. Moreover, a closed-form asymptotic expression for the error probability of the considered system is derived and then comprehensive computer simulations have been performed to validate the accuracy of the authors' analytical results. It is shown that results obtained by the proposed MGF and asymptotic error expressions are in good agreement with their corresponding simulation results.
